MI6 Launches Dark Web Portal to Recruit Spies Globally

Introduction to Silent Courier

In a significant step towards bolstering national security, the UK’s foreign intelligence agency, MI6, has introduced a new dark web platform named Silent Courier. This initiative aims to streamline the recruitment of spies, focusing specifically on attracting potential agents from Russia and beyond. By leveraging secure messaging technology, MI6 is set to enhance the efficiency of its recruitment processes, a move that highlights the agency’s commitment to adapting to contemporary security challenges.

How Silent Courier Works

Starting Friday, individuals wishing to share sensitive information concerning terrorism or hostile intelligence activities can access the Silent Courier portal. This platform is designed to allow secure communication with MI6, offering potential informants a safe avenue to report risks to national security. The MI6 will provide clear instructions on using this portal through their verified YouTube channel, ensuring that those interested can easily navigate the process.

Security Recommendations for Users

When reaching out via Silent Courier, users are urged to utilize reliable VPNs and devices disconnected from their personal identities, ensuring maximum anonymity and security in their communications. This recommendation is critical, as prospective agents are submitting potentially sensitive information that could have serious implications for their safety.

Official Announcement and Global Context

The launch of Silent Courier will be publicly addressed by the outgoing chief of MI6, Sir Richard Moore, in Istanbul. During his announcement, he is expected to extend an invitation: “Today we’re asking those with sensitive information on global instability, international terrorism or hostile state intelligence activity to contact MI6 securely online. Our virtual door is open to you.”

This initiative follows a trend observed in other regions, notably the CIA’s efforts in 2023, where video campaigns targeted potential Russian spies via social media. By adopting similar outreach strategies, MI6 aligns itself with a growing global approach to intelligence recruitment that leverages modern communication channels.
